#b1cd54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1cd54 is composed of 69.4% red, 80.4%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 59%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 73.9 degrees, a saturation of 54.8% and a lightness of 56.7%. #b1cd54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#639b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#b1cd54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b1cd54 has RGB values of R:177, G:205,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 11652436.
